  • Visit to Woodlands, Margaret River. I have read a lot about Woodlands, however overall this was quite a disssapointing visit, wines lacked any sort of drive; quite linear and weak in the mid-palate, and even though they were well made they all missed a little something. The Woodlands Cabernet Sauvignon was probably the highlight, however at $229 AUD it was a hard pass. At $100 this would be an easy buy

    This is more of a second wine from their estate from my understanding, Cab Sauvignon dominated; dark black and red fruits, cedar, sweet spices. crushed florals, palate is slightly creamy, round with fine but structured tannins, good mid-palate depth and a medium finish. The finish is what really disappointed me about all Woodlands wines....
